New foundation launches ambitious research programme into sharks, skates and rays
The waters around the Isle of Man are home to more fascinating marine life than many realise. A new Manx Shark Foundation has just launched with an exciting mission: to uncover the secrets of sharks, skates, and rays that inhabit our coastal waters and help visitors and residents understand these magnificent creatures better.
The foundation is committed to advancing shark science and conservation through collaboration with researchers, local anglers, fisheries experts, and ocean enthusiasts. This innovative approach brings together diverse groups who share a passion for protecting Manx marine life and understanding the species that make our waters unique.
If you spot a shark, skate, or ray during your visit or your time on the Island, you can contribute to this important research. The foundation is asking the public to report sightings through the Manx Dolphin and Whale Watch charity, a trusted organisation already doing excellent work monitoring marine mammals in our waters.
